作 者:游兴河[1]
机构地区:[1]合肥工业大学
出 处:《复合材料学报》1994年第1期29-35,共7页Acta Materiae Compositae Sinica
摘 要:本文研究了WC在WC/钢复合材料中的溶解行为。用电子探针及扫描电镜能谱分析进行相成分的定性和定量分析;用X射线衍射仪进行物相分析;用光学显微镜和透射电镜观察了复合材料的显微组织。结果表明,WC/钢复合材料在烧结和热处理过程中,WC与钢基体将发生相互溶解与沉淀析出作用。文中还讨论了由于WC的溶解引起钢基体的化学成分变化,及其对复合材料的热处理、组织结构及性能的影响。Dissolving behavioar of WC in WC/steel composite material has been investigated.Qualitative and quantitative ana yses of the phasecomposition have been conducted with an electron probe and SEM. The phase structure analyses have been performed by using an X-ray diffracto-meter. The microstructure of the composite material has been examined by using optical microscope and TEM. Results are shown that dissolving andprecipitation processes between WC and steel matrix of the WC/steel com-posite material occur during sintering and heat treatment because of theinteraction between WC and steel matrix,and the chemical composition of thematrix changed. This may affect the heat treatment process and the struc-ture and properties of the composite material.
